SolaX X3-PRO-12K-G2 12 kW grid-connected string inverter, 3-phase
Soon available again
The 3-phase X3‑PRO-12K-G2 from SolaX (MPN: 1030090047) is a grid-connected string inverter with a nominal AC power of 12 kW, which can be used flexibly for residential and commercial buildings. You control the feed-in via integrated export power limitation in accordance with the grid and use intelligent load management to supply consumers such as heat pumps or wall boxes according to demand. It supports 150% DC oversizing and 110% AC overload, allowing you to maximize your PV yield even during peak loads and fluctuating irradiation. With 32 A per MPP tracker, global MPP scan, and a wide MPPT voltage range, it quickly and stably finds the optimal operating point, which brings additional kilowatt hours, especially with east/west orientations, partial shading, and low sunlight.

Integrated export power control function
This ensures that only the permitted amount of electricity is fed into the public grid, down to zero feed-in. A SolaX Energy Meter measures your home consumption in real time, and the inverter automatically adjusts its output. Self-consumption comes first, and feed-in limits such as 70% or a fixed kW value are reliably adhered to. External controllers are not necessary; what is important is the correct installation of the electricity meter and the appropriate country or grid configuration in the device.

150% DC oversizing, 110% AC power
150% DC oversizing means that you can connect 1.5 times more module power to the PV input than the inverter's AC rated power. This increases the yield in low light conditions. Power peaks are then "clipped" to the inverter limit if necessary. 110% AC overload output means that the inverter can feed in up to approx. 13.2 kW (at 12 kW AC rated power) for a short time. It is crucial to observe the MPPT limits for voltage, input current, and short-circuit current (including Voc at lowest temperatures) as well as thermal conditions and grid specifications.
Integrated global MPP scan
The inverter automatically checks the entire permissible voltage range of your PV strings and selects the best operating point. This prevents yield losses due to partial shading, different orientations, or soiling and reliably increases the power yield. The scan runs automatically at defined intervals (e.g., at startup) and can slightly change the power output for a short time—no additional hardware is required.

Parallel connection
The series inverter is parallel-capable. You can connect several devices to one system and control the feed-in together, right down to zero feed-in. A SolaX meter installed in the main circuit (at the grid connection point) measures the energy flow, and the inverters regulate their output synchronously. The connection can be made either via Modbus or the DataHub (sold separately). Please observe the wiring diagrams specified by the manufacturer and ensure correct cabling and addressing.

Arc fault detection (AFCI) - optional
If your PV modules, connectors, or cables are incorrectly installed or damaged, arcing can occur, which can cause fires. To quickly prevent such fires, SolaX has developed optional arc detection. This feature can be installed and provides a higher level of safety for you and your PV system.

Technical data
PV input
- Max. recommended PV power: 18 kWp
- Max. PV input voltage: 1100 V
- Nominal PV input voltage: 650 V
- Operating voltage range: 135 - 985 V
- MPPT voltage range: 160 - 980 V
- Start voltage: 200 V
- Number of MPPT's: 2
- Strings per tracker: 2
- Max. input current per MPPT: 32 A
- Max. short-circuit current per MPPT: 40 A
AC output
- Nominal output power: 12 kW
- Nominal output current: 18.2 A
- Max. apparent output power: 13.2 kVA
- Max. continuous output current: 19.3 A
- AC rated voltage: 3/N/PE, 220/380 V, 3/N/PE, 230/400 V
- AC rated frequency: 50/60 Hz
General
- Max. efficiency: 98.2%
- European efficiency: 97.7%
- Cooling: Natural cooling
- Protection class: IP66
- Operating temperature range: -30°C to +60°C
- Weight: 24.5 kg
- Dimensions: 482 x 417 x 186 mm
